What Changed in One UI 8.5’s Battery Settings

If you’ve owned the A56 since launch and just updated to the Galaxy A56 One UI 8.5 update battery layout, the Galaxy A56 battery settings changed One UI 8.5 interface is noticeably different now, and it’s genuinely a nice change.

Go to Settings > Battery and you’ll see the Galaxy A56 One UI 8.5 new battery UI dashboard has been redesigned. It now shows your estimated remaining time up front, current charging status, and a full week of daily Battery Usage Since Last Full Charge history in one scrollable view, instead of the old single-day snapshot buried a tap deeper in Device Care. I actually use this now, where before I mostly ignored the battery screen because it took too many taps to see anything useful. To dive deeper into system options, see our guide on the best One UI settings for Samsung A56.

Galaxy A56 power saving mode also got simplified. Where older One UI versions had three tiers (Optimized, Medium, Max), One UI 8.5 now offers two: Standard, which gives moderate savings with customizable limits you can adjust yourself, and Maximum, which disables all non-essential features in one go. Fewer options, but honestly more useful, since Standard now lets you pick exactly which limits apply instead of guessing what “Medium” used to restrict.

Why Battery Drain Gets Worse Right After a Software Update

This is the part almost nobody explains properly, and it’s the single biggest source of frustration I’ve seen from other A56 owners asking: “Why does my Galaxy A56 battery die so fast after update?” So let’s actually go through it instead of just saying “give it time.”

After updating to One UI 8.5 (or if you previously experienced Galaxy A56 battery drain One UI 7 releases), a lot of A56 users — myself included — noticed battery life get noticeably worse, sometimes needing a charge twice a day where once was normal, occasionally paired with Galaxy A56 overheating and battery drain even during light use. When people report this to Samsung support, the standard reply is that after a major update, the device may temporarily consume more power while performing background optimization, app updates, and usage pattern learning, and that battery performance may differ from normal during this period. That’s a real explanation verified in Android System Developer Documentation, not just corporate deflection — it does happen — but it’s incomplete, and it doesn’t help if your battery is still bad two weeks later.

Here’s what I actually did to sort real post-update drain from temporary adjustment drain:

  • Clear the One UI Home cache. The launcher accumulates temporary files that can trigger excess background activity after an update. Go to Settings > Apps, search for One UI Home, tap Storage, then Clear Cache. This alone fixed a chunk of my post-update drain within a day.
  • Turn off Nearby Device Scanning. This feature constantly searches for nearby Samsung devices like Buds or a Watch, running in the background even if you’re not using any accessories. Go to Settings > Connections > More connection settings, and toggle it off. It won’t affect manually connecting Bluetooth devices, it just stops the constant passive scanning.
Samsung Galaxy A56 Nearby Device Scanning turned off to prevent background battery drain
Samsung Galaxy A56 Nearby Device Scanning turned off to prevent background battery drain
  • Update your keyboard app. This one sounds unrelated but genuinely isn’t — an outdated Samsung Keyboard version has been linked to unnecessary battery drain after major updates. Check the Galaxy Store for a Samsung Keyboard update and install it if available.
  • Check for a corrupted app rather than assuming it’s the OS. Go to Settings > Battery and look at the usage breakdown by app over the past several days using the new week-view. If one specific app spikes right after the update while everything else looks normal, that app — not the update itself — is usually the actual problem. Force stop it, clear its cache, and see if the drain follows.
  • Give it a genuine week before concluding it’s permanent. Adaptive Battery and background learning really do need time to recalibrate after a big OS change, so if none of the above shows an obvious culprit, a week of normal use before judging is fair. But two weeks with zero improvement and no identifiable app usually means it’s a real bug, not adjustment. At that point, a full cache partition wipe (via Recovery Mode) or, worst case, performing a soft or factory reset on the Galaxy A56 backed up through Smart Switch tends to resolve it when nothing else does. The Settings That Actually Made a Difference for Me

I tested a lot of things that didn’t do much — closing apps manually from recent apps, for example, barely made a dent because Android already manages that reasonably well. Here’s what genuinely helped for best battery settings Galaxy A56 2026 configuration, ranked roughly by impact.

1. Switching Refresh Rate to Standard (Not Adaptive) When Needed

I know this sounds counterintuitive since Adaptive is supposed to be the smart choice. The A56’s display defaults to Adaptive, meaning it dynamically switches up to 120Hz depending on content. In practice, evaluating Galaxy A56 Motion Smoothness battery impact showed that high refresh rates trigger more often than you’d expect — home screen, Chrome, Instagram scrolling all fire off 120Hz. On longer battery days, manually dropping to Standard (60Hz) gave me close to an extra hour of screen-on time in my own side-by-side testing, checked over several days using the new weekly usage view.

2. Turning Off Always-On Display Entirely, or Switching to Tap to Show

I didn’t disable it permanently because I do like glancing at notifications without unlocking. Setting it to Tap to show instead of Show always (Settings > Lock screen > Always On Display) saved a chunk of battery I wasn’t expecting, and checking my stats afterward showed AOD had quietly accounted for 30–45 minutes of “screen on” time daily before the change.

3. Using Deep Sleeping Apps Instead of Restricting Manually One-by-One

This replaced most of what I used to do app-by-app. More detail in the Exynos section below, but configuring your Galaxy A56 Deep Sleeping Apps setting is the single most effective set-and-forget change I made.

4. Disabling RAM Plus

Exynos 1580-Specific Fixes: RAM Plus and Deep Sleeping Apps

Most battery guides give you the same generic Android advice regardless of chipset. But the Galaxy A56 Exynos 1580 battery optimization process requires understanding a couple of hardware quirks worth addressing directly, because the default settings aren’t necessarily doing you favors here.

Samsung Galaxy A56 RAM Plus feature disabled in memory settings to reduce battery drain
Samsung Galaxy A56 RAM Plus feature disabled in memory settings to reduce battery drain

Galaxy A56 RAM Plus battery draw can be surprising. RAM Plus lets the phone use part of your internal storage as virtual memory, in theory letting more apps stay cached in the background so they reopen faster. The problem is that storage-based virtual memory is meaningfully slower than physical RAM, and on the A56 it can end up working against you — more background caching means more background power draw, for a fluidity benefit that’s honestly hard to notice in daily use. I disabled mine (Settings > Battery > Memory > RAM Plus > toggle off > Restart) and didn’t lose anything I actually cared about. If you don’t like the abrupt change, you can also just lower the amount of storage allocated instead of switching it off entirely.

Background Usage Limits, found under Settings > Battery > Background usage limits, is the feature I now use instead of manually restricting apps one at a time:

  • Sleeping apps: Background activity is limited but not fully blocked.
  • Deep sleeping apps: Background activity is blocked entirely until you open the app yourself.
  • Never sleeping apps: Apps you specifically want to keep fully active in the background, like a messaging app you need instant alerts from.

I put almost everything I use less than a few times a week into Deep Sleeping — old shopping apps, an airline app, a couple of games I open once in a blue moon, plus a handful of preinstalled Samsung apps I can’t uninstall but never actually use. Everything I check daily but don’t need instant alerts from (news, weather) went into regular Sleeping. Messaging, banking, and email stayed in Never Sleeping.

Note: Right after disabling RAM Plus, my phone actually felt slightly rougher for about a day — a touch of lag, marginally warmer than usual. That settled down within 24–48 hours as the system adjusted, which lines up with what other Exynos A-series owners have reported too. If you try this and it feels off initially, give it a day or two before assuming something’s wrong.

Adaptive Battery, Properly Explained

Galaxy A56 Adaptive Battery not working is a common complaint among new owners, largely because how it works gets mentioned constantly in passing and almost never actually explained.

  • What it does: It learns which apps you use often and which ones you rarely touch, gradually restricting background activity for the rarely-used ones without you having to manually manage every app yourself.
  • How long it takes to learn: In my experience, roughly a week of fairly normal, varied usage before it starts making noticeably smarter decisions. It’s not instant — it needs to actually observe a pattern across different days, including weekends versus weekdays, since usage habits often shift.
  • How to check what it’s restricting: Settings > Battery > More battery settings > Adaptive Battery doesn’t give you a detailed breakdown by default, but you can cross-reference this with Settings > Battery and the app usage list in the weekly view — apps showing minimal background activity despite being installed for a while are usually the ones it’s already limiting.
  • How to override it for a specific app: If Adaptive Battery restricts something you actually need running (I had this happen with a package tracking app that was delaying delivery notifications), go to Settings > Battery > Background usage limits > Never sleeping apps, and add it there manually. This tells the system to leave that app alone regardless of how rarely you open it.

Security Settings That Quietly Save Battery

This connection doesn’t get made often, but it’s real: apps with more permissions than they need tend to run more background processes, and more background processes mean more battery drain. Reframing your security settings as a battery step killed two birds for me.

Permission Manager

Go to Settings > Security and privacy > Permission manager, and go through camera, microphone, and especially location access. I found two apps with “Allow all the time” location permissions I’d completely forgotten granting, neither of which needed constant background location for what I actually use them for. Switching both to “While using the app” stopped a slow, steady drain I’d never have traced back to permissions otherwise.

Auto Blocker

Found under Settings > Security and privacy > Auto Blocker. Galaxy A56 Auto Blocker battery protection benefits are real: this feature blocks unauthorized software commands and installs from outside official app stores. As of One UI 8.5, it also added a temporary disable option with an automatic 30-minute re-enable timer, so if you need to sideload something briefly, you’re not left exposed indefinitely. Keeping this on doesn’t just protect you from malicious software — it also prevents rogue background processes from unauthorized sources that could otherwise be silently draining power.

Display Tweaks That Save Real Power

Since the AMOLED screen is one of the biggest power draws on this phone, small display changes add up more than people expect.

  • Manual Brightness Control: Dropping brightness from auto to a manual setting around 50–60% indoors made a visible difference in my daily percentage drop. Auto-brightness on the A56 tends to run brighter than strictly necessary in mixed indoor lighting, especially given the panel supports up to 1,200 nits peak brightness.
  • AMOLED Dark Mode: Dark mode helps too, and not just marginally — because it’s an AMOLED panel, black pixels use less power than white ones (Settings > Display > Dark). I switched my wallpaper to a darker image as well, since even the home screen background affects power draw slightly on OLED-type displays.
  • Screen Timeout: Screen timeout is another easy one. I had mine set to 2 minutes out of habit; dropping it to 30 seconds under Settings > Display > Screen timeout saved more than I expected, mostly because I tend to leave my phone face-up on the desk without realizing the screen’s still on.

Troubleshooting Fast Charging & Common Mistakes

If you are encountering issues where samsung galaxy a56 fast charging not working as expected, it can severely compound your daily battery battery management issues. The Galaxy A56 supports Super Fast Charging up to 45W wired (Super Fast Charge 2.0), but getting those maximum speeds requires specific hardware and settings alignment.

If your charging rates feel painfully slow or your phone displays “Charging” instead of “Super Fast Charging 2.0”, check these key elements:

  • Verify Software Toggles: Ensure fast charging is enabled in software (Settings > Battery > More battery settings > Fast charging).
Samsung Galaxy A56 Fast Charging and Battery Protection toggles in One UI 8.5 settings
  • Power Delivery & PPS Support: Make sure you are using a USB-PD 3.0 charger that explicitly supports PPS (Programmable Power Supply) rated for 45W. Older charging bricks without PPS will default to standard 15W charging, even if they claim high overall wattage.
  • Cable Rating: You must use a 5A-rated USB-C to USB-C cable for 45W charging; standard 3A cables cap out at 25W.
  • Thermal Throttling: If the phone is hot, the Exynos 1580 thermal protection will throttle charging speeds down automatically to prevent Standby Drain and battery degrade.

Other Common Mistakes to Avoid

  • Force-closing apps constantly: This doesn’t help and can actually hurt battery life, since apps have to fully reload and re-establish background processes when reopened, which uses more power than letting the system manage them normally.
  • Setting Maximum power saving mode permanently: It’s tempting because the battery numbers look great, but it disables so much at once — dimmed screen, restricted background activity across the board, disabled non-essential features — that daily use starts feeling noticeably limited. It’s meant for stretching a dead battery through the end of a day, not everyday use.
  • Assuming post-update drain will just fix itself with no action: As covered above, sometimes it genuinely does resolve on its own within a week. But plenty of the time it’s a specific corrupted cache or a single problem app, and waiting around indefinitely without checking wastes days of poor battery life for no reason.
  • Ignoring app updates: A buggy app version can silently drain battery through background processes that get fixed in later updates. I had one app running a battery-draining bug for almost two weeks before an update patched it.
  • Leaving RAM Plus and Deep Sleeping Apps on default settings: They work reasonably well out of the box, but a few minutes of manual configuration based on your actual usage does noticeably better than the defaults alone.
  • Poor Charging Habits & Battery Protection: Letting the battery repeatedly drop to near 0% before charging isn’t great for long-term health. Consider using Battery Protection / Optimized Battery Charging features under settings to keep charge limits healthy over time.

Should I disable RAM Plus on the Galaxy A56?

It’s worth trying. On the Exynos 1580, RAM Plus’s virtual memory can end up costing more in background battery use than it gives back in multitasking speed. Expect a day or so of minor roughness after disabling it before things settle.

What’s the difference between Sleeping apps and Deep Sleeping apps?

Sleeping apps have limited but not fully blocked background activity. Deep Sleeping apps are blocked from running in the background entirely until you manually open them. Use Deep Sleeping for apps you rarely touch but still want installed.
